The Systems Approach for Better Education Results (SABER)
School autonomy and accountability
The World Bank Group has focused its efforts in education in two strategic directions: reforming education systems at the country level and building a high-quality knowledge base for education reforms at the global level.The Systems Approach for Better Education Results (SABER) is helping the Bank realize this goal. At the country level, it provides education systems analyses, assessments, diagnosis, and opportunities for dialogue. At the global level, it improves the education systems knowledge base and uses this information to implement effective reforms.Using diagnostic tools and detailed policy information, SABER produces comparative data and knowledge about education system policies and institutions. It evaluates the quality of those education policies against evidence-based global standards, with the aim of helping countries systematically strengthen their education systems. (About SABER)
